Roles & Responsibilities

  1. Design, develop, test, and maintain robotic process automation workflows that streamline repetitive business operations and improve organizational efficiency through intelligent automation solutions.
  2. Collaborate with business stakeholders, analysts, and technical teams to understand process requirements and convert operational challenges into scalable automation solutions.
  3. Develop and deploy RPA components such as bots, automation scripts, logging systems, repositories, and workflow configurations to support enterprise automation initiatives.
  4. Support the implementation and launch of automation solutions while ensuring smooth deployment, stability, and operational readiness across business environments.
  5. Assist in process analysis and automation design by identifying optimization opportunities and recommending efficient workflow improvements for business functions.
  6. Create technical documentation, process guides, and end-user support materials to ensure automation systems remain understandable, maintainable, and user-friendly.
  7. Conduct testing and quality assurance activities to validate automation workflows, identify issues, and ensure system performance meets business expectations.
  8. Troubleshoot technical problems and support production environments by diagnosing automation failures, debugging issues, and ensuring minimal disruption to operations.
  9. Work closely with development and cross-functional teams to integrate automation systems effectively with existing applications and enterprise platforms.
  10. Maintain awareness of emerging technologies, automation trends, and business process innovations to continuously improve technical capabilities and automation effectiveness.

Requirements & Eligibility

  1. Candidates should possess basic programming and scripting knowledge, including familiarity with technologies such as Python, Java, .NET, or related development frameworks.
  2. Understanding of SQL and relational databases is preferred for handling structured data, querying systems, and supporting automation-driven workflows.
  3. Knowledge of application development principles and software engineering fundamentals will be beneficial for creating scalable and maintainable automation systems.
  4. Familiarity with process analysis, system design, implementation, and testing methodologies is important for understanding business automation lifecycles.
  5. Strong problem-solving and analytical thinking skills are essential for troubleshooting automation failures, debugging workflows, and optimizing system performance.
  6. Understanding of quality assurance processes and software testing techniques is preferred to ensure automation workflows function correctly and reliably.
  7. Good communication and collaboration skills are required for working effectively with stakeholders, technical teams, and business process owners.
  8. Candidates should demonstrate a strong interest in learning emerging technologies and automation platforms, especially robotic process automation tools and enterprise systems.
  9. A proactive mindset, adaptability, and willingness to work in fast-paced international environments are highly valuable for success in this role.
  10. Fresh graduates or entry-level professionals with enthusiasm for automation engineering, software development, and intelligent business technologies are strongly encouraged to apply.

Expected Salary

The expected salary for an Associate Software Engineer, RPA at ASSA ABLOY in Chennai generally ranges between ₹4.5 LPA and ₹8 LPA, depending on educational background, technical proficiency, project exposure, and performance during the hiring process. Candidates with stronger knowledge of Python, Java, SQL, automation concepts, or software development principles may receive higher compensation packages.
